Regarding your question about US/UK Vanity Fair: as far as I know they are virtually the same, only the advertisements are different, and sometimes the covers differ, because the editors feel the subject is better suitable for just the US (or UK) audience; just like last year, the American version had Anderson Cooper on the cover, and the UK one had to do with Keri Russel.
